We have both supported this Charity for the past ten years and have taken part in various events and made donations along the way. It is one we both feel very passionate about, as it is a local hospice that functions purely on the generosity of the community it provides for. The New Build a Dream Hospice that is currently being built will enable St Barnabas to provide hospice care for the people who stay there and support family and friends on a greater scale.
